Output ae8c4e9d9d168f8c80b13b5ed5d37a4bd164c1507166d7ea48eb151944161646:2

value
359941
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f75d4e12f8f56748aec99a604d17ebb7977ebd27 OP_EQUAL
address
3QExbsNeypAjAc1U8rvW2mEEB31ehTQTeZ
transaction
ae8c4e9d9d168f8c80b13b5ed5d37a4bd164c1507166d7ea48eb151944161646
confirmations
315809
spent
true